Handoff 使用Swift实现了iOS上面的Handoff功能,可以在两台iOS设备上进行协同工作。可以在当前设备关闭的同时在另一台设备上观察到最新内容。 1.Handoff简介 iOS8
原文 http://www.cocoachina.com/swift/20151125/14390.html 要做一个全功能的绘图板,至少要支持以下这些功能: 支持铅笔绘图(画点) 支持画直线
翻译 作者: Krzysztof 原文: Writing Xcode plugin in Swift GitHub上的源代码 在我的 AppCode 项目创建过程中,我想念最多的一件事
Swift开发的Runkeeper设计开关控件 (two part segment control)。 Requirements Xcode 7-beta or higher iOS 8.0 or
上篇如何在 Swift中调用C库(进阶篇) 中,我们已经解决了大部分的问题,本篇我们来讲讲如何完善这个示例。 之前我们的示例中包含了以下几个项目: hiredis-bridge 用于桥接兼容hiredis库中的一些方法。
Swift 2.0 中,引入了可用性的概念。对于函数,类,协议等,可以使用 @available 声明这些类型的生命周期依赖于特定的平台和操作系统版本。而 #available 用在判断语句中(if,
通过在实现转场动画的类中定义协议方法,定义代理属性,明确谁可以提供需要的frame和imageView,将对方设置为代理,让代理提供需求,达到转场目的.
http://finalshares.com/read-7027 已更新至 Xcode7.2、Swift2.1 在第一次打开App或者App更新后通常用引导页来展示产品特性 我们用 NSUserDefaults
前言 最近还是有不少朋友老问Swift版的自动计算行高怎么做,大家使用SnapKit来自动布局时,都希望能够自动地计算出行高,不用每次都自己去算一篇。 本篇介绍笔者所开源的基于SnapKit这
来自: http://swift.gg/2016/02/02/being-swifty-with-collection-view-and-table-view-cells/ 作者:Jameson Quave,
系统的UISegmentControl虽然可以动态计算宽度,但是不能滚动。0..0鉴于需求,所以还是苦逼自己撸了一个Swift版。满足动态调节segment宽度,以及自动调整滚动位置,选择红点显示。 效果图:
介绍 AXBadgeView-Swift 是一个badge view管理类,是之前我写的 AXBadgeView 的Swift版本(以下的介绍中统一使用 AXBadgeView ),在新版本中没有
swift在iOS开发中越来越普及,大家都认同swift将是iOS的未来,从objc切换到swift只是时间问题。但是,对于老的objc项目,特别是开发积累了2、3年的老项目,从objc转换到swift,基本上不太现实。
可以理解为一张银行卡。拿着这张卡到银行,说我要存,就够了。这个枚举就是一个ID。 这个思路和Swift 3以后的通知中心形式相似。 Notification.Name 也是一个 rawValue
Swift 的 extension 机制很强大,不仅可以针对自定义的类型,还能作用于系统库的类型,甚至基础类型比如 Int 。当在对系统库做 extension 的时候,就会涉及到一个命名冲突的问题。Objective-C
哈希算法,加上看了 MrPeak 的 a 闲聊 Hash 算法 ,所以我就去仔细看了下 Swift 中的相关内容与概念。这篇文章算是对 Swift 中对象的“等同性”、“比较”、“哈希”概念的一个简单介绍。 Equatable
也可以。 另外,Swift 也提供默认的使用级别给典型的使用场景。确实,如果你编写一款单一目标的 app,你可能根本不需要明确地指定访问控制级别。 模块和源文件 Swift的访问控制模型是基于模块和源文件的概念。
我耗费了大半暑期来琢磨Swift作为一门函数是编程语言都能做些什么,而今已经转移 到使用Swift来开发库文件了。我花了一天的时间,最后发觉之前做的Swift特性探究是相当愉快的经历,我发现仍旧需要学习如何去做一些最基本的琐
苹果 Swift 语言的爱好者将可以用 Swift 为 Windows 和 Android 开发软件了 。 Silver 编译器 能 编译 Swift 代码运行在 .NET 和 Java 运行时上。开发
最近苹果手表预订火爆,再次揭示了科技行业一个规律——“苹果做什么什么都能火”。大约一年前,苹果推出了新的编程语言 Swift。最近的一个程序员民调显示,该语言已经成为最受欢迎的编程语言,做到了后来居上。 最近,程序员